Follicular lymphoma (FL) frequently transforms into diffuse large B‐cell lymphoma (DLBCL). To clarify the associated clinicopathological prognostic parameters, we examined the correlation of 11 histopathological parameters with progression‐free survival (PFS) and overall survival (OS) in 107 consecutive patients who had DLBCL with pre‐existing (asynchronous) or synchronous FL. The patients comprised 58 men and 49 women with a median age of 56 years. For DLBCL, the complete response rate was 81%, overall response rate was 88%, and 5‐year PFS and OS rates were 55% and 79%, respectively. Immunohistochemical analysis of the DLBCL component revealed the following positivity rates: CD10, 64%; Bcl‐2, 83%; Bcl‐6, 88%; MUM1, 42%; GCB, 82%; cMyc index ≥80%, 17%; and Ki‐67 index ≥90%, 19%. IGH/BCL2 fusion was positive in 57% of DLBCL cases. In univariate analyses, asynchronous FL and DLBCL (24%, P = 0.021), 100% proportion of DLBCL (29%, P = 0.004), Bcl‐2 positivity (P = 0.04), and high Ki‐67 index (P = 0.003) were significantly correlated with shorter PFS. Asynchronous FL and DLBCL (P = 0.003), 100% proportion of DLBCL (P = 0.001), and high Ki‐67 index (P = 0.004) were significantly correlated with shorter OS. In a multivariate analysis, asynchronous FL and DLBCL (P = 0.035) and 100% proportion of DLBCL (P = 0.016) were significantly correlated with shorter OS. Thus, asynchronism and 100% proportion of DLBCL, that is, FL relapsed as pure DLBCL, or FL and DLBCL at different sites, were significant predictors of unfavorable outcome of patients with DLBCL transformed from FL.  相似文献

This study aimed to clarify the clinicopathological prognostic parameters of de novo diffuse large B‐cell lymphoma (DLBCL) in the rituximab era. We examined the correlation of 22 clinicopathological parameters with progression‐free survival (PFS), overall survival (OS), and primary refractory disease in 285 DLBCL patients treated with rituximab‐containing chemotherapy. Complete response rate was 87%, overall response rate was 91%, 5‐year PFS rate was 72%, and 5‐year OS rate was 91%. By log–rank test, higher International Prognostic Index (IPI) (P < 0.0001), Bcl‐2 positivity (P = 0.0013), Bcl‐6 negativity (P = 0.0112), and no irradiation (P = 0.0371) were significantly correlated with shorter PFS; higher IPI (P = 0.0107), starry sky pattern (P = 0.0466), and no irradiation (P = 0.0264) correlated with shorter OS. In multivariate analyses, higher IPI (P = 0.0006), Bcl‐2 positivity (P = 0.0015), and Bcl‐6 negativity (P = 0.04) were significantly correlated with shorter PFS; higher IPI (P = 0.0045) correlated with shorter OS. Bcl‐2 (P = 0.0029), Bcl‐6 (P = 0.002), and IPI (P < 0.0001) were significantly correlated with primary refractory disease. In conclusion, Bcl‐2 positivity, Bcl‐6 negativity, and higher IPI were indicators of shorter PFS and OS plus primary refractory disease in patients with DLBCL in the rituximab era.  相似文献

The interaction between CD47 and signal‐regulatory protein‐α (SIRPα) inhibits phagocytosis, thus affecting the clinical outcomes of neoplastic diseases. Although CD47 upregulation is associated with poor prognosis in several malignancies, the effect of SIRPα expression and its coexpression with CD47 remains unclear. This study aimed to investigate the clinicopathologic effect of CD47 and SIRPα expression in diffuse large B‐cell lymphoma (DLBCL). Immunostaining of 120 biopsy samples showed that CD47 is primarily expressed in tumor cells, whereas SIRPα is expressed in nonneoplastic stromal cells, mostly macrophages. CD47high cases showed higher MYC protein expression and lower MYC translocation. The SIRPαhigh cases presented significantly shorter overall survival (OS) and progression‐free survival (PFS) than SIRPαlow cases in the activated B‐cell (ABC) subtype of DLBCL (P = .04 and P = .02, respectively). Both CD47high and SIRPαhigh presented significantly shorter OS and PFS than other cases among all DLBCL patients (P = .01 and P = .004, respectively), and the ABC type (P = .04 and P = .008, respectively) but not the germinal center B‐cell type. Both CD47high and SIRPαhigh yielded a constant independent prognostic value for OS and PFS in multivariate analysis (hazard ratio [HR], 2.93; 95% confidence interval [CI], 1.20‐7.43; P = .02; and HR, 2.87; 95% CI, 1.42‐5.85; P = .003, respectively). To the best of our knowledge, this is the first study to report that combinatorial CD47 and SIRPα expression is a potential independent prognostic factor for DLBCL. Evaluation of CD47 and SIRPα expression could be useful before CD47 blockade therapy.  相似文献

Background: Age is an adverse prognostic factor in diffuse large B cell lymphoma (DLBCL), but there are limited data on the outcomes of patients' ≥80 years, including those treated with dose reduced chemoimmunotherapy. Patients and Methods: We conducted a retrospective analysis of 542 patients, 85 (16%) were ≥80 years of age. Results: Although the very elderly group had more frequent comorbidities and decreased performance status, 89% received therapy. Four-year PFS was 42% vs. 61% (P < .001) in patients ≥80 years vs. younger patients, while 4-year OS was 42% vs. 72% (P < .0001), respectively. In patients treated with anthracycline-containing regimens (n = 416) 4-year cumulative incidence of relapse with death as competing risk was not different between age groups. Median survival for DLBCL patients ≥80 years treated with R-CHOP or R-miniCHOP was 4.5 years. Survival after first relapse was significantly different between age groups: 5 vs. 19 months (P = .002), respectively.Conclusion: Very elderly DLBCL patients have worse OS and PFS compared with younger patients but can achieve long term disease control and potentially be cured with chemoimmunotherapy. Older DLBCL patients treated with effective regimens do not have increased rates of relapse, but outcomes after relapse remain poor.  相似文献

BackgroundThe SADAL study evaluated oral selinexor in patients with relapsed and/or refractory diffuse large B-cell lymphoma (DLBCL) after at least 2 prior lines of systemic therapy. In this post-hoc analysis, we analyzed the outcomes of the SADAL study by DLBCL subtype to determine the effects of DLBCL subtypes on efficacy and tolerability of selinexor.Patients and MethodsData from 134 patients in SADAL were analyzed by DLBCL subtypes for overall response rate (ORR), overall survival (OS), duration of treatment response, progression-free survival, and adverse events rate.ResultsORR in the entire cohort was 29.1%, and similar in patients with germinal center (GCB) versus non-GCB DLBCL (31.7% vs. 24.2%, P = 0.45); transformed DLBCL showed a trend towards higher ORR than de novo DLBCL: 38.7% vs. 26.2% (P = 0.23). Despite similar prior treatment regimens and baseline characteristics, patients with DLBCL and normal C-MYC/BCL-2 protein expression levels had a significantly higher ORR (46.2% vs.14.8%, P = 0.012) and significantly longer OS (medians 13.7 vs. 5.1 months, hazard ratio 0.43 [95% CI, 0.23-0.77], P = 0.004) as compared with those whose DLBCL had C-MYC and BCL-2 overexpression. Among patients who had normal expression levels of either C-MYC or BCL-2 and baseline hemoglobin levels ≥ 10g/dL, ORR was 51.5% (n = 47), with median OS of 15.5 months and median PFS of 4.6 months. Similar rates of adverse events were noted in all subgroups.ConclusionsOverall, single agent oral selinexor showed strong responses in patients with limited treatment alternatives regardless of germinal center B-cell type or disease origin.  相似文献

Epstein‐Barr virus (EBV)‐positive diffuse large B‐cell lymphoma (DLBCL) is a haematologic malignancy with poor prognosis when treated with chemotherapy. We evaluated response and survival benefits of chemoimmunotherapy in EBV‐positive DLBCL patients. A total of 117 DLBCL patients were included in our retrospective analysis; 33 were EBV‐positive (17 treated with rituximab, cyclophosphamide, doxorubicin, vincristine, and prednisone [R‐CHOP] and 16 with CHOP), and 84 were EBV‐negative (all treated with R‐CHOP). The outcomes of interest were complete response (CR) and overall survival (OS) in EBV‐positive DLBCL patients (R‐CHOP versus CHOP) and in DLBCL patients treated with R‐CHOP (EBV‐positive vs EBV‐negative). There were no differences in the clinical characteristics between EBV‐positive and EBV‐negative DLBCL patients. Among EBV‐positive DLBCL patients, R‐CHOP was associated with higher odds of CR (OR 3.14, 95% CI 0.75‐13.2; P = .10) and better OS (hazard ratio 0.30, 95% confidence interval [CI] 0.09‐0.94; P = .04). There were no differences in CR rate (OR 0.52, 95% CI 0.18‐1.56; P = .25) or OS (hazard ratio 0.93, 95% CI 0.32‐2.67; P = .89) between EBV‐positive and EBV‐negative DLBCL patients treated with R‐CHOP. Based on our study, the addition of rituximab to CHOP is associated with improved response and survival in EBV‐positive DLBCL patients. Epstein‐Barr virus status does not seem to affect response or survival in DLBCL patients treated with R‐CHOP.  相似文献

Pediatric infratentorial ependymomas are difficult to cure. Despite the availability of advanced therapeutic modalities for brain tumors, total surgical resection remains the most important prognostic factor. Recently, histological grade emerged as an independent prognostic factor for intracranial ependymoma. We retrospectively reviewed the treatment outcome of 33 pediatric patients with infratentorial ependymoma. Progression-free survival (PFS) and overall survival (OS) rates were calculated and relevant prognostic factors were analyzed. Fourteen patients (42%) were under the age of 3 at diagnosis. Gross total resection was achieved in 16 patients (49%). Anaplastic histology was found in 13 patients (39%). Adjuvant therapies were delayed until progression in 12 patients (36%). Actuarial PFS rates were 64% in the first year and 29% in the fifth year. Actuarial OS rates were 91% in the first year and 71% in the fifth year. On univariate analysis, brainstem invasion (P = 0.047), anaplastic histology (P = 0.004), higher mitotic count (P = 0.001), and higher Ki-67 index (P = 0.004) were significantly related to a shorter PFS. Gross total resection (P = 0.029) and a greater age at diagnosis (P = 0.033) were significantly related to a longer PFS. On multivariate analysis, anaplastic histology alone was significantly related to a shorter PFS (P = 0.023). Gross total resection (P = 0.039) was significantly related to a longer overall survival (OS) on multivariate analysis. Anaplastic histology and gross total resection were the most important clinical factors affecting PFS and OS, respectively. Anaplastic histology, mitotic count, and Ki-67 index can be used as universal and easily available prognostic parameters in infratentorial ependymomas.  相似文献

Decreased absolute lymphocyte counts (ALCs) following frontline therapy for chronic lymphocytic leukemia may be associated with disease control, even in patients without evidence of minimal residual disease. We studied the prognostic significance of ALCs during the first year following treatment with fludarabine, cyclophosphamide, and rituximab (FCR). We evaluated 99 patients who achieved a partial response without lymphocytosis (<4.0 × 103cells/μL) or better after FCR. Absolute lymphocyte counts were recorded at 3‐, 6‐, 9‐, and 12‐month posttreatment and correlated with overall survival (OS) and event‐free survival (EFS). For each time point, analyses were limited to patients without lymphocytosis, so as to avoid possible biases from undocumented disease progressions. Lymphopenia (ALC < 1.0 × 103cells/μL) at 3 m after FCR (69% of patients n = 68), was associated with a longer OS (5y OS 91% vs 64%, P = .001), as were ALC ≤ 2 × 103 cells/μL at 6 m (5y OS 85% vs 48%, P = .004) and ALC ≤ 1.8 × 103 cells/μL at 9 m (5y OS 93% vs 54%, P = .009). A normal‐range ALC (≤4 × 103 cells/μL) at 12 m was also associated with a 91% 5y OS. Higher ALCs (but without lymphocytosis) were associated with shorter EFS (median EFS 27 months for ALC > 1.8 vs not reached for ALC ≤ 0.7 at 9 months, P < .0001). In conclusion, lower ALC levels in the first few months following frontline FCR therapy were associated with longer OS and EFS. Possible explanations may be that lower ALCs reflect deeper clonal suppression or protracted Treg depletion. Absolute lymphocyte count levels may be a cheap and widely available prognostic marker, though the added value for clinical practice is the minimal residual disease era needs to be explored.  相似文献

The MIB‐1 labeling index, which is based on Ki67 immunostaining, is widely used to evaluate the proliferation of tumor cells in lymphoma. However, its clinical significance has not been fully assessed. We retrospectively evaluated the prognostic impact of the MIB‐1 labeling index at the time of diagnosis, in 98 patients with follicular lymphoma (FL) grade 1–3b who were treated uniformly with rituximab plus cyclophosphamide, doxorubicin, vincristine, and prednisolone (R‐CHOP) therapy. The 5‐year progression‐free survival (PFS) for an MIB‐1 labeling index of ≥10% (n = 60) and <10% (n = 38) was 35% and 61%, respectively (P = 0.015). The 5‐year overall survival (OS) for an MIB‐1 labeling index of ≥10% and <10% was 77% and 92%, respectively (P = 0.025). Pathological grading was not correlated with PFS or OS. In multivariate analysis, an MIB‐1 labeling index of ≥10% was independently associated with poor PFS and OS. In conclusion, an MIB‐1 labeling index of 10% is a useful cut‐off level for predicting the prognosis of patients with FL.  相似文献

BackgroundThe human T-cell lymphotropic virus type 1 (HTLV-1) is associated with aggressive diseases, such as adult T-cell leukemia/lymphoma (ATLL). However, less is known on the impact of HTLV-1 infection in non-ATLL hematologic malignancies. We aimed to investigate if HTLV-1 carriers with diffuse large B-cell lymphoma (DLBCL) have worse survival outcomes than non-HTLV-1 carriers.Materials and MethodsWe performed a single-center retrospective cohort study by matching HTLV-1 carriers to non-carriers based on age, sex, Ann Arbor stage, and year of diagnosis. Our outcomes of interest were overall survival (OS) and progression-free survival (PFS). The Kaplan-Meier method was used to estimate OS and PFS between carriers and non-carriers. We fitted multivariate Cox regression models to assess the mortality and recurrence/disease progression risk of HTLV-1 infection.ResultsA total of 188 patients, 66 with HTLV-1 infection and 122 without HTLV-1, were included in the study. HTLV-1 carriers had higher extranodal involvement than non-carriers (47% vs. 27%, P = .010). With a median follow-up of 78 months (95% CI: 41-90 months), HTLV-1 carriers had a similar 5 year OS (41% vs. 42%, P = .940) and PFS (34% vs. 32%, P = .691) compared to non-carriers. In the multivariate Cox analysis, HTLV-1 infection was not associated with worse OS (aHR: 0.98, 95% CI: 0.64-1.50) or PFS (aHR: 0.90, 95% CI: 0.60-1.34).ConclusionHTLV-1 carriers with DLBCL did not have worse survival outcomes compared to non-carriers. Our results suggest that clinicians should follow standard guidelines for DLBCL management on HTLV-1 seropositive patients.  相似文献

Positron emission computed tomography (PET/CT) in patients with diffuse large B-cell lymphoma (DLBCL) enrolled in a prospective clinical trial were reviewed to test the impact of quantitative parameters from interim PET/CT scans on overall (OS) and progression-free (PFS) survival. We centrally reviewed baseline and interim PET/CT scans of 138 patients treated with rituximab plus cyclophosphamide, doxorubicin, vincristine and prednisone given every 14 days (R-CHOP14) in the SAKK38/07 trial ( ClinicalTrial.gov identifier: NCT00544219). Cutoff values for maximum standardized uptake value (SUVmax), metabolic tumor volume (MTV), total lesion glycolysis (TLG) and metabolic heterogeneity (MH) were defined by receiver operating characteristic analysis. Responses were scored using the Deauville scale (DS). Patients with DS 5 at interim PET/CT (defined by uptake >2 times higher than in normal liver) had worse PFS (P = 0.014) and OS (P < 0.0001). A SUVmax reduction (Δ) greater than 66% was associated with longer PFS (P = 0.0027) and OS (P < 0.0001). Elevated SUVmax, MTV, TLG, and MH at interim PET/CT also identified patients with poorer outcome. At multivariable analysis, ΔSUVmax and baseline MTV appeared independent outcome predictors. A prognostic model integrating ΔSUVmax and baseline MTV discriminated three risk groups with significantly (log-rank test for trend, P < 0.0001) different PFS and OS. Moreover, the integration of MH and clinical prognostic indices could further refine the prediction of OS. PET metrics-derived prognostic models perform better than the international indices alone. Integration of baseline and interim PET metrics identified poor-risk DLBCL patients who might benefit from alternative treatments.  相似文献

Epigenetic silencing of the O6-methylguanine-DNA-methyltransferase (MGMT) gene by promoter methylation is correlated with improved progression-free survival (PFS) and overall survival (OS) in adult patients with newly diagnosed glioblastoma multiforme (GBM) who receive alkylating agents. The aim of this study is to determine the correlation between MGMT and survival in elderly patients with GBM treated with radiotherapy (RT) and temozolomide (TMZ). Eighty-three patients aged 70 years or older with histologically confirmed GBM treated with RT plus TMZ between February 2005 and September 2009 were investigated in this study. The methylation status of the MGMT promoter was determined by polymerase chain reaction analysis. Median PFS and OS were 7.5 and 12.8 months, respectively. The MGMT promoter was methylated in 42 patients (50.6%) and unmethylated in 41 patients (49.4%). Median OS was 15.3 months in methylated patients and 10.2 months in unmethylated patients (P = 0.0001). Median PFS was 10.5 months in methylated tumors and 5.5 months in unmethylated tumors (P = 0.0001). On multivariate analysis MGMT methylation status emerged as the strongest independent prognostic factor for OS and PFS (P = 0.004 and P = 0.005, respectively). The results of the present study suggest that MGMT methylation status might be an important prognostic factor associated with better OS and PFS in elderly patients with GBM treated with RT and TMZ.  相似文献

BackgroundRituximab has dramatic impact on outcome of patients with diffuse large B-cell lymphoma (DLBCL), especially nongerminal center (non-GC) type. A low absolute lymphocyte count (ALC) before rituximab, cyclophosphamide, vincristine, adriamycin, and prednisone (R-CHOP) therapy as a surrogate marker of immune status is associated with poor clinical outcome in DLBCL. Therefore, we hypothesized that low ALC before R-CHOP would have effect on the survival in non-GC type.Patients and methodsOne hundred and thirty-six DLBCL patients who were treated with R-CHOP from 2003 to 2007 were analyzed in the present study.ResultsALC ≥1.0 × 109/l predicted a longer 3-year progression-free survival (PFS) and 3-year overall survival (OS) versus ALC <1.0 × 109/l (82.6% versus 60.0%, P = 0.005 and 87.2% versus 62.0%, P < 0.001, respectively). Non-GC type had similar PFS and OS to germinal center type (68.2% versus 80.0%, P = 0.074 and 72.7% versus 82.9%, P = 0.111, respectively). However, considering clinical influence of the ALC according to immunophenotype, low ALC in non-GC type DLBCL was associated with lower PFS and OS compared with others (PFS, P = 0.002; OS, P < 0.001). Multivariate analysis revealed that low ALC in non-GC type had lower PFS [hazard ratio (HR) = 3.324, P = 0.001] and OS (HR = 4.318, P < 0.001), independent of international prognostic index.ConclusionA low ALC in non-GC type DLBCL counteracted the beneficial effect of rituximab on survival.  相似文献

BackgroundPatients with relapsed/refractory diffuse large B-cell lymphoma (DLBCL) have a poor prognosis, even in the rituximab era. Several studies have reported the clinical importance of the peripheral blood lymphocyte-to-monocyte ratio (LMR) in various malignancies, including lymphoma. However, the prognostic value of the LMR in relapsed/refractory DLBCL has not been well evaluated. The purpose of the present study was to investigate whether the LMR at relapse can predict clinical outcomes for relapsed/refractory DLBCL patients treated with rituximab.Patients and MethodsWe analyzed data on 74 patients with relapsed/refractory DLBCL, who were initially treated with R-CHOP (rituximab and cyclophosphamide, doxorubicin, vincristine, and prednisone) or an R–CHOP-like regimen.ResultsThere was a significant association between a low LMR (≤ 2.6) and shorter overall survival (OS; P < .001) and progression-free survival (PFS; P < .001) compared with the high LMR group (> 2.6). Multivariate analysis showed that LMR was an independent prognostic factor for OS (P < .001) and PFS (P < .001), as was the international prognostic index (IPI) at relapse for OS. In addition, the LMR had an incremental value for OS and PFS compared with the IPI at relapse.ConclusionThe LMR predicts OS and PFS outcomes in relapsed/refractory DLBCL patients treated with rituximab, and might facilitate better stratification among patients in low- and intermediate-risk IPI groups.  相似文献

Although clinical use of positron emission tomography–computed tomography (PET‐CT) scans is well established in aggressive lymphomas, its prognostic value in marginal zone lymphoma (MZL) remains yet unclear. Hence, we investigated potential role of PET‐CT in predicting MZL patients' outcomes following systemic chemotherapy. A total of 32 patients with MZL who received first‐line chemotherapy were included in the analysis. They all underwent pretreatment, interim, and posttreatment PET‐CT scans. The primary objective was to evaluate the role of complete metabolic response (CMR) in posttreatment PET‐CT scans in predicting progression‐free survival (PFS). Compared with non‐CMR group, 5‐year PFS rate was significantly higher in patients who achieved CMR in posttreatment PET‐CT (54.2% vs 0.0%, P = .003) and also in patients gaining CMR in interim PET‐CT scans (62.5% vs 15.6%, P = .026). Interestingly, early CMR group, who achieved and maintained CMR in both interim and posttreatment PET‐CT scans, showed significantly higher 5‐year PFS than those with delayed or never CMR group (62.5% vs 37.5% vs 0%, P = .008). Therefore, interim and/or posttreatment CMR can be prognostic at least in these subsets of patients with MZL treated with chemotherapy.  相似文献

The outcomes and best treatment strategies for germline BRCA1/2 mutation (gBRCAm) carriers with metastatic breast cancer (MBC) remain uncertain. We compared the overall survival and the first line progression free survival (PFS1) of patients with a gBRCAm identified at initiation of first-line treatment with those of BRCA wild-type (WT) and not-tested (NT) individuals in the ESME real-world database of MBC patients between 2008 and 2016 (NCT03275311). Among the 20 624 eligible patients, 325 had a gBRCAm, 1138 were WT and 19 161 NT. Compared with WT, gBRCAm carriers were younger, and had more aggressive diseases. At a median follow-up of 50.5 months, median OS was 30.6 (95%CI: 21.9-34.3), 35.8 (95%CI: 32.2-37.8) and 39.3 months (95% CI: 38.3-40.3) in the gBRCAm, WT and NT subgroups, respectively. Median PFS1 was 7.9 (95%CI: 6.6-9.3), 7.8 (95%CI: 7.3-8.5) and 9.7 months (95%CI, 9.5-10.0). In the multivariable analysis conducted in the whole cohort, gBRCAm status had however no independent prognostic impact on OS and PFS1. Though, in the triple-negative subgroup, gBRCAm patients had better OS and PFS1 (HR vs WT = 0.76; 95%CI: 0.60-0.97; P = .027 and 0.69; 95% CI: 0.55-0.86; P = .001, respectively). In contrast, in patients with HR+/HER2 negative cancers, PFS1 appeared significantly and OS non significantly lower for gBRCAm carriers (PFS1: HR vs WT = 1.23; 95%CI: 1.03-1.46; P = .024; OS:HR = 1.22, 95% CI: 0.97-1.52, P = .089). In conclusion, gBRCA1/2 status appears to have divergent survival effects in MBC according to IHC subtype.  相似文献

BackgroundThe ABO blood group is reported to be associated with survival for several types of malignancy. We conducted a retrospective study to evaluate the prognostic significance of the ABO blood group in patients with malignant lymphoma.Patients and MethodsA total of 523 patients with malignant lymphoma were included in this study. The primary outcome measured was the association between the ABO blood group and survival.ResultsPatients with blood group B had shorter 5-year overall survival (OS) than patients with non-B blood groups (40.9% vs. 57.3%; P < .01). Among 240 patients with diffuse large B-cell lymphoma (DLBCL), patients with blood group B had shorter 5-year OS in comparison with patients with non-B blood groups (36.3% vs. 56.9%; P < .01). Among male patients with DLBCL, those with blood group B had significantly shorter 5-year OS than those with non-B blood groups (27.5% vs. 55.8%; P = .003). On the other hand, there was no significant difference in the survival between female patients with blood group B and those with non-B blood groups (5-year OS: 49.2% vs. 58.2%; P = .67). A multivariate analysis demonstrated that blood group B (hazard ratio, 1.83; 95% confidence interval, 1.21-2.78; P = .04) was an independent predictor of shorter OS in male patients with DLBCL.ConclusionThe ABO blood group is associated with survival in patients with lymphoma. Interestingly, only male patients with DLBCL with blood group B had significantly shorter OS than those male patients with DLBCL with non-B blood groups.  相似文献

To report long-term results for children with low-grade hypothalamic/chiasmatic gliomas treated on a phase II chemotherapy protocol. Between 1984 and 1992, 33 children with hypothalamic/chiasmatic LGGs received TPDCV chemotherapy on a phase II prospective trial. Median age was 3.0 years (range 0.3–16.2). Twelve patients (36%) underwent STRs, 14 (42%) biopsy only, and seven (21%) no surgery. Twenty patients (61%) had pathologic JPAs, nine (27%) grade II gliomas, and four (12%) no surgical sampling. Median f/u for surviving patients was 15.2 years (range 5.3–20.7); 20 of the 23 surviving patients had 14 or more years of follow-up. Fifteen-year PFS and OS were 23.4 and 71.2%, respectively. Twenty-five patients progressed, of whom 13 are NED, two are AWD, and 10 have died. All children who died were diagnosed and first treated at age three or younger. Age at diagnosis was significantly associated with relapse and survival (P = 0.004 for PFS and P = 0.037 for OS). No PFS or OS benefit was seen with STR versus biopsy/no sampling (P = 0.58 for PFS, P = 0.59 for OS). For patients with JPAs and WHO grade II tumors, the 15-year PFS was 18.8 and 22.2% (P = 0.95) and 15-year OS was 73.7 and 55.6% (P = 0.17), respectively. Upfront TPDCV for children with hypothalamic/chiasmatic LGGs resulted in 15-year OS of 71.2% and 15-year PFS of 23.4%. No survival benefit is demonstrated for greater extent of resection. Age is a significant prognostic factor for progression and survival.  相似文献

Recent studies have shown that metabolic tumor volume (MTV) by positron emission tomography/computed tomography (PET/CT) is an important prognostic parameter in patients with non‐Hodgkin's lymphoma. However, it is unknown whether doxorubicin, bleomycin, vinblastine, dacarbazine (ABVD) alone in early stage Hodgkin's lymphoma would lead to similar disease control as combined modality therapy (CMT) using MTV by PET/CT. One hundred and twenty‐seven patients with early stage Hodgkin's lymphoma who underwent PET/CT at diagnosis were enrolled. The MTV was delineated on PET/CT by the area ≥SUVmax, 2.5 (standardized uptake value [SUV]). Sixty‐six patients received six cycles of ABVD only. The other 61 patients received CMT (involved‐field radiotherapy after 4–6 cycles of ABVD). The calculated MTV cut‐off value was 198 cm3. Clinical outcomes were compared according to several prognostic factors (i.e. age ≥50 years, male, performance status ≥2, stage II, B symptoms, ≥4 involved sites, extranodal site, large mediastinal mass, CMT, elevated erythrocyte sedimentation rate and high MTV). Older age (progression‐free survival [PFS], P = 0.003; overall survival [OS], P = 0.007), B symptoms (PFS, P = 0.006; OS, P = 0.036) and high MTV (PFS, P = 0.008; OS, P = 0.007) were significant independent prognostic factors. Survival of two high MTV groups treated with ABVD only and CMT were lower than the low MTV groups (PFS, P < 0.012; OS, P < 0.045). ABVD alone was sufficient to control disease in those with low MTV status. However, survival was poor, even if the CMT was assigned a high MTV status. The MTV would be helpful for deciding the therapeutic modality in patients with early stage Hodgkin's lymphoma.  相似文献
